用語解説

インフラ・クラウド

スケーラビリティとは

概要スケーラビリティとは、システムやサービスが利用者や処理量の増加に応じて性能や規模を柔軟に拡張できる能力を指します。IT業界では、Webサービスやアプリケーションが急速にユーザーを獲得した際にも、安定した動作を保つために重要な概念です。正...
インフラ・クラウド

サーバーレスとは

概要サーバーレスとは、アプリケーションを実行する際に、開発者がサーバー(コンピュータ)を管理する必要がないクラウドコンピューティングの仕組みのことです。「サーバーがない」という意味ではなく、「サーバーの存在を意識しなくても使える」という意味...
インフラ・クラウド

Docker Composeとは

概要Docker Compose(ドッカー・コンポーズ)とは、複数のDockerコンテナをまとめて管理・起動できるツールです。通常、アプリケーションは1つのコンテナだけではなく、Webサーバー、データベースなど複数のサービスを連携させて動か...
バックエンド

PHPとは

概要Webサイト開発に使われるプログラミング言語です。HTMLと組み合わせて動的なページを作るのが得意です。特にサーバーサイド(バックエンド)の処理を担当し、動的なページの生成やフォームの処理、データベースとの連携が簡単に行えます。正式名称...
フロントエンド

DOM操作とは

DOM操作とは?DOM操作とは、Webページの構造をJavaScriptなどのプログラムで動的に変更することを指します。HTMLは本来「静的」な構造ですが、JavaScriptを使ってテキストの変更・画像の差し替え・要素の追加や削除など、リ...
フロントエンド

DOMとは

DOMとは?HTMLやXML文書をプログラムで扱いやすくするための構造(モデル)です。Webブラウザは、HTMLを読み込むときにこのDOMを内部的に作成し、JavaScriptからこの構造を操作できるようにしています。たとえば、ページ内の見...
フロントエンド

JavaScriptとは

概要Webページに動きを加えるためのプログラミング言語です。HTMLやCSSと組み合わせることで、ボタンを押したときの反応やアニメーション、データの動的な表示などを実現できます。JavaScriptは、Google ChromeやSafar...
フロントエンド

CSSとは

概要HTMLで作られたWebページにデザイン(色、レイアウト、フォントなど)を加えるためのスタイルシート言語です。「見出しを青くしたい」「ボタンを中央に配置したい」「文字を大きくしたい」といった視覚的な調整は、すべてCSSで指定します。例え...
フロントエンド

HTMLとは

概要ウェブページを作成するためのマークアップ言語です。ウェブブラウザがHTMLを解釈し、テキスト、画像、リンクなどを含むウェブページとして表示します。HTMLはウェブの基礎技術の一つであり、CSSやJavaScriptと組み合わせて使用され...